Because a pelmet encloses the top of a window, it restricts air leaks around loose-fitting windows and helps to halt air currents that develop as room air and window leaks merge. With insulated curtains in front of the window and a pelmet blocking airflow at the top, heated or cooled room air stays in the room and intruding outside air remains behind the curtains.
